# Protocol

BitAgent is built on **Unibase AIP**, **Membase**, and **ve(3,3)**.

***

## Protocol Stack

| Layer                | Component       | Role                                            |
| -------------------- | --------------- | ----------------------------------------------- |
| Identity & Discovery | ERC-8004        | On-chain agent identity and discovery           |
| Payment              | X402            | Agent-to-agent real-time payment                |
| **Collaboration**    | **AIP**         | Cross-platform collaboration and Memory sharing |
| Memory               | Membase         | Decentralized, tamper-proof permanent memory    |
| Incentives           | ve(3,3) + Bribe | Staking and governance rewards                  |

## AIP (Agent Interoperability Protocol)

AIP solves **cross-platform collaboration** and **Memory sharing** — enabling agents to discover, interact, and share knowledge across platforms without centralized intermediaries.

| Capability                       | Description                                              |
| -------------------------------- | -------------------------------------------------------- |
| **Cross-platform collaboration** | Message exchange and coordination across platforms       |
| **Memory sharing**               | Agents share knowledge and context with each other       |
| **ERC-8004 identity**            | Standard-compliant on-chain agent identity and discovery |

## Commerce & Settlement (ERC-8183)

Agent Commerce (ERC-8183) is the settlement layer for the BitAgent ecosystem, providing fee escrow and settlement for Agent-to-user and Agent-to-agent transactions.

* **Escrow**: Payment held in escrow until work is verified and completed.
* **Implementation**: Deployed on **BSC and Base** (mainnet + testnet) as the [AIP Settlement Layer](/bitagent-docs/protocol/erc8183-agent-commerce.md); X Layer Testnet settles via OKX OptimisticEscrow. See [Networks & Contracts](/bitagent-docs/reference/contracts.md).

## Membase (Permanent Memory)

Membase is the decentralized memory layer for AI agents — persistent conversation storage, scalable knowledge bases, and secure on-chain collaboration, built for agent learning and evolution.

| Capability                  | Description                                                                                       |
| --------------------------- | ------------------------------------------------------------------------------------------------- |
| **Multi-Memory Management** | Multiple conversation threads with preload and auto-upload to the Membase Hub                     |
| **Knowledge Base**          | Build, expand, and synchronize agent knowledge with vector storage                                |
| **Long-Term Memory (LTM)**  | Auto-summarizes conversation history into structured long-term memory for retrieval and reasoning |
| **On-chain Identity**       | Cryptographic identity verification and agent registration for trustless collaboration            |
